#34730e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#34730e is composed of 20.4% red, 45.1%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 87.8%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 97.4 degrees, a saturation of 78.3% and a lightness of 25.3%. #34730e color hex could be obtained by blending #68e61c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

#34730e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#34730e has RGB values of R:52, G:115, B:14 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0, Y:0.88,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 3437326.

Shades and Tints of #34730e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050a01 is the darkest color, while #fafef8 is the lightest one.
